Why AI matters at this scale
County of Lapeer, Michigan, employs between 200 and 500 people serving a rural community from its seat in Lapeer. Like most mid-sized county governments, it operates with lean administrative teams stretched across essential functions: property assessment, public health, courts, vital records, and social services. Budgets are tight, technology stacks are often a patchwork of legacy systems, and the demand for faster, more transparent service continues to rise. AI—specifically intelligent automation—offers a path to do more with the same headcount, reducing backlogs and letting skilled staff focus on complex, human-centric work.
For a county this size, AI isn't about building custom machine learning models from scratch. It's about leveraging proven, off-the-shelf tools: robotic process automation (RPA), intelligent document processing (IDP), and conversational AI. These technologies can slot into existing workflows without massive IT overhauls, and they address the number-one pain point in local government: manual, repetitive paperwork. With the right grants and vendor partnerships, Lapeer can achieve meaningful efficiency gains within a single budget cycle.
Three concrete AI opportunities with ROI framing
1. End-to-end vital records automation. The County Clerk's office processes thousands of birth, death, and marriage certificate requests annually. Today, staff manually key data from paper forms and PDFs into the state vital records system. An IDP solution using OCR and natural language processing can extract names, dates, and locations with over 95% accuracy, routing only low-confidence exceptions to a human. This could cut processing time per record from 15 minutes to under 3, saving an estimated 2,000 staff hours per year—roughly $50,000 in direct labor—while improving turnaround for citizens.
2. RPA for public benefits eligibility. The Health Department and Michigan Department of Health and Human Services partners spend significant time verifying applicant data across multiple state and federal databases. RPA bots can log into these systems, perform the cross-checks, and populate case files automatically. A pilot in a similar Michigan county reduced eligibility determination time by 60% and virtually eliminated data-entry errors. For Lapeer, this could mean redeploying two full-time eligibility workers to higher-value outreach and case management.
3. AI-powered constituent chatbot. The county website fields hundreds of repetitive questions weekly: “When are property taxes due?”, “How do I apply for a building permit?”, “What are the court clerk’s hours?” A generative AI chatbot trained on county ordinances, FAQs, and department procedures can answer these 24/7 in plain language. Early adopters in local government report deflecting 25-35% of calls and emails, reducing front-desk interruptions and improving citizen satisfaction scores.
Deployment risks specific to this size band
Mid-sized counties face a unique set of risks. First, vendor lock-in and procurement complexity can stall projects; Lapeer must ensure any AI tool complies with Michigan’s procurement rules and integrates with existing Tyler Technologies or Laserfiche systems. Second, data quality in older record systems may be inconsistent, requiring a cleanup phase before automation can run reliably. Third, workforce resistance is real—staff may fear job loss. Transparent communication and upskilling programs are essential to frame AI as a tool that eliminates drudgery, not jobs. Finally, cybersecurity and privacy must be front and center, especially when handling protected health information or criminal justice data. On-premises or government-cloud deployments with strict access controls are non-negotiable. Starting small with a single department pilot, measuring hard savings, and building internal champions will de-risk the journey and build momentum for broader adoption.
